Become a Preferred Member and Support VoyagerRadio!A few days ago I recommended all VoyagerRadio listeners to upgrade to Preferred Membership to receive all kinds of benefits. Let me now explain what some of those benefits are.
By becoming a Preferred Member you'll get fewer (if any) commercial interruptions while listening to VoyagerRadio and other Live365 webcasts, and you'll never see banner ads nor pop-up ads ever again. Those reasons alone make the low subscription fee valuable enough for me, but you'll also get access to all the VIP-only Live365 stations. (Live365 stations have a cap on the number of listeners that can tune into any station at any one time. All Live365 stations have these limits, which vary widely depending on the plan each webcaster pays for. As a Preferred Member, you can listen to any of these stations even after their cap has been reached.) Additionally, by becoming a Preferred Member you will also help support this burgeoning Internet radio community.
